Fidelity National Information Servcs Inc vs Nvidia Corp — how do they compare? Fidelity National Information Servcs Inc trades at $42.9 (market cap $21.92B), while Nvidia Corp trades at $217.88 (market cap $5.27T). The key difference: Nvidia Corp is far larger — about 240.4× Fidelity National Information Servcs Inc's market cap, and Fidelity National Information Servcs Inc pays the higher dividend (4.14%). About Fidelity National Information Servcs Inc

Fidelity National Information Services' legacy operations provide core and payment processing services to banks, but its business has expanded over time. By acquiring Sungard in 2015, the company now provides record-keeping and other services to investment firms. With the acquisition of Worldpay in 2019, FIS now provides payment processing services for merchants and holds leading positions in the United States and United Kingdom. About a fourth of revenue is generated outside North America.

About Nvidia Corp

NVIDIA Corporation designs, develops, and markets three dimensional (3D) graphics processors and related software. The Company offers products that provides interactive 3D graphics to the mainstream personal computer market.
